Pascale Gerbault is a scholar working on Genetics, Paleontology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pascale Gerbault has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Genetics, 5 papers in Paleontology and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Pascale Gerbault's work include Digestive system and related health (7 papers), Nutrition, Genetics, and Disease (5 papers) and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(5 papers). Pascale Gerbault is often cited by papers focused on Digestive system and related health (7 papers), Nutrition, Genetics, and Disease (5 papers) and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(5 papers). Pascale Gerbault coll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Switzerland and United States. Pascale Gerbault's co-authors include Mark Thomas, Mathias Currat, Joachim Bürger, Alicia Sanchez‐Mazas, Dallas M. Swallow, Anke Liebert, Adam Powell, Yuval Itan, Marit E. Jørgensen and Peter Bjerregaard and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
